Establishing the Structure Effectively
To ensure your personalized deck stands the examination of time, setting the foundation appropriately is necessary. Start by noting the deck's format with risks and string, ensuring it's square and level. Next, dig holes for your wikipedia reference grounds a minimum of 36 inches deep, below the frost line, to stop changing. Use concrete to safeguard the footings, permitting it to cure totally. Once established, connect post anchors to the footings, guaranteeing they're plumb and lined up. Mount your assistance light beams, making certain they're level and spaced according to your design. Ultimately, add joists, adhering to local building regulations for spacing. By taking these steps, you'll create a strong structure that supports your deck for many years to find.
Laying Down Decking Boards
Laying down outdoor decking boards is a vital action in developing a durable and appealing deck. Usage deck screws or concealed bolts to safeguard it in place, maintaining it vertical to the joists below.
As you continue, maintain a regular gap between each board to permit for drain and development. Action and cut the boards as needed, confirming a tight fit at the ends. It's essential to look for level as review you go, changing the boards if essential. Make use of a chalk line to lead your placement, helping you keep every little thing straight. Once all your boards are down, offer whatever an once-over to verify it's secure and well-aligned before relocating on to the following steps.

Seasonal Upkeep Checklist
As the seasons modification, it's important to remain on top of your deck's upkeep to protect its elegance and long life. Beginning by inspecting for any type of indicators of damages, such as splintered boards or loose railings. Clean your deck completely by sweeping away debris and making use of a gentle see post cleaner to remove discolorations. In the springtime, consider applying a fresh layer of sealant to protect versus moisture. During the summer season, check for any kind of mold and mildew or mold development, particularly in dubious locations. In the loss, clear fallen leaves and particles to stop rot, and evaluate for any kind of winter months damage. In winter season, think about utilizing a snow blower rather than shoveling to stay clear of scratching the surface area. Maintaining this checklist in mind will guarantee your deck remains in leading form year-round.
